X-Git-Url: https://git.cyclocoop.org/?a=blobdiff_plain;f=LocalSettings.sample;h=b78d3f07969dd3e4577ab12723a5c185f7a75fae;hb=795cf110189a9c9f8d844e612849d2fc3510aa37;hp=0bafdf70e56a7f897e6fa549db74bb3a8d8fd96b;hpb=2fb4c16f6424581b70e0c30a285f8ba8a6887c29;p=lhc%2Fweb%2Fwiklou.git diff --git a/LocalSettings.sample b/LocalSettings.sample index 0bafdf70e5..b78d3f0796 100644 --- a/LocalSettings.sample +++ b/LocalSettings.sample @@ -1,62 +1,217 @@ -"; # MySQL settings # +# The user you specify here DOES NOT NEED TO EXIST. +# It is created by the installation script, if +# you have root privileges on your database. +# +# IF on the other hand you have only limited privs +# on your DB and have to do a manual install, use +# your existing username and password. Be sure this +# file doesn't get left around on the web legible... +# +# $wgDBsqluser is used for queries through the +# web interface. It is also created by the script. +# Unlike the regular user, it has no write +# permissions and can not access passwords. +# $wgDBserver = "localhost"; -$wgDBuser = "wikiuser"; $wgDBname = "wikidb"; -$wgDBpassword = "userpass"; +$wgDBuser = "wikiuser"; +$wgDBpassword = "userpass"; # Use a better password! ;) +$wgDBsqluser = "sqluser"; $wgDBsqlpassword = "sqlpass"; -$wgDBminWordLen = 3; # Match this to your MySQL fulltext -$wgDBtransactions = false; # Set to true if using InnoDB tables -# Turn this on during database maintenance -# $wgReadOnly = true; +## Minimum word length for the full-text search. +## NOTICE: Changing this value does not suffice. You must +## also change the corresponding setting in MySQL itself. +## See the MySQL manual for information on how to do so. +# +$wgDBminWordLen = 3; + +## Set these to true to turn on some optimizations when using +## MySQL 4.x: +# +# $wgDBmysql4 = true; +# $wgEnablePersistentLC = true; + +## You can customize the interface messages through the wiki; +## see [[MediaWiki:All pages]]. (This requires a sysop account.) +## This causes a performance hit, though; if you don't need it, +## feel free to turn it off: +# +# $wgUseDatabaseMessages = false; + +## Set $wgUseImageResize to true if you want to enable dynamic +## server side image resizing ("Thumbnails") +# +# $wgUseImageResize = true; + +## Resizing can be done using PHP's internal image libraries +## or using ImageMagick. The later supports more file formats +## than PHP, which only supports PNG, GIF, JPG, XBM and WBMP. +## +## Set $wgUseImageMagick to true to use Image Magick instead +## of the builtin functions +# +# $wgUseImageMagick = true; +# $wgImageMagickConvertCommand = "/usr/bin/convert"; + +## If you have the appropriate support software installed +## you can enable inline LaTeX equations: +# $wgUseTeX = true; +# $wgMathPath = "{$wgUploadPath}/math"; +# $wgMathDirectory = "{$wgUploadDirectory}/math"; +# $wgTmpDirectory = "{$wgUploadDirectory}/tmp"; -# Turn this on to get HTML debug comments -# $wgDebugComments = true; +$wgLocalInterwiki = $wgSitename; -# If you want a non-English wiki, add a line like this +## If you want a non-English wiki, add a line like this # $wgLanguageCode = "de"; -$wgUseTeX = false; -$wgLocalInterwiki = "w"; +## Character encoding: normally auto-selected by the language. +## English, German, Danish, Dutch, French, Spanish, and Swedish +## will be in ISO-8859-1 by default, all other languages in +## UTF-8 encoding. UTF-8 is more flexible, but some older browsers +## have trouble with it. You can force an English-language wiki +## to UTF-8 by uncommenting the lines below. The other languages +## mentioned above might not work properly this way without +## additional tweaking. +# +# $wgInputEncoding = "UTF-8"; +# $wgOutputEncoding = "UTF-8"; -$wgInputEncoding = "ISO-8859-1"; -$wgOutputEncoding = "ISO-8859-1"; +## Default skin: you can change the default skin. Use the internal symbolic +## names, ie 'standard', 'nostalgia', 'cologneblue', 'monobook': +# $wgDefaultSkin = 'monobook'; -# Extremely high-traffic wikis may want to disable -# some database-intensive features here: +## Extremely high-traffic wikis may want to disable +## some database-intensive features here: # # $wgDisableTextSearch = true; # $wgDisableCounters = true; # $wgMiserMode = true; +## The following three config variables are used to define +## the rights of users in your system. +# +# If wgWhitelistEdit is set to true, only logged in users +# are allowed to edit articles. +# If wgWhitelistRead is set to an array of page names, only logged in users +# are allowed to read pages *not in the list*. +# +# wgWhitelistAccount lists user types that can add user accounts: +# "key" => 1 defines permission if user has right "key". +# +# Typical setups are: +# +# Everything goes (this is the default behaviour): +# $wgWhitelistEdit = false; +# $wgWhitelistRead = false; +# $wgWhitelistAccount = array ( "user" => 1, "sysop" => 1, "developer" => 1 ); +# +# Invitation-only closed shop type of system +# $wgWhitelistEdit = true; +# $wgWhitelistRead = array ( ":Main_Page" ); +# $wgWhitelistAccount = array ( "user" => 0, "sysop" => 1, "developer" => 1 ); +# +# Public website, closed editorial team +# $wgWhitelistEdit = true; +# $wgWhitelistRead = false; +# $wgWhitelistAccount = array ( "user" => 0, "sysop" => 1, "developer" => 1 ); + + +# Squid-related settings +# +# Enable/disable Squid +# $wgUseSquid = true; +# If you run Squid3 with ESI support, enable this (default:false): +# $wgUseESI = true; +# Internal server name as known to Squid, if different +# $wgInternalServer = 'http://yourinternal.tld:8000'; +# Cache timeout for the squid, will be sent as s-maxage (without ESI) or +# Surrogate-Control (with ESI). Without ESI, you should strip out s-maxage in the Squid config. +# 18000 seconds = 5 hours, more cache hits with 2678400 = 31 days +# $wgSquidMaxage = 18000; +# A list of proxy servers (ips if possible) to purge on changes +# don't specify ports here (80 is default) +# $wgSquidServers = array('127.0.0.1'); ?>